Output 17a8e86485c21ab9e83f5676d1d661173725f668fc84bdc2c6470d0113007a59:1

value
2979328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f4e8083d588b07a4cfcb42a60ed07b14468f3f OP_EQUAL
address
34srHTbJqjttkC5P6qTbgcMr7pXF5FhxXT
transaction
17a8e86485c21ab9e83f5676d1d661173725f668fc84bdc2c6470d0113007a59
spent
true